Monthly Temperature in Side
The climate in Side is known for significant temperature differences throughout the year, making the weather dynamic. Average daytime temperatures reach a very warm 33°C (91°F) in August. In January, the coolest month of the year, temperatures drop to a moderate 15°C (59°F).
At night, temperatures range from around 25°C (77°F) in August to 8°C (46°F) in January.

Rainfall in Side
Side has a notably wet climate with abundant precipitation, recording 1005 mm (40 in) of rainfall per year. Side can be quite wet during January, receiving approximately 205 mm (8.1 in) of precipitation over 14 rainy days.
In contrast, during the driest month (July), you will experience much drier conditions, with 4 mm (0.2 in) of precipitation spread across 6 rainy days. For more details, please visit our Side Precipitation page.

Sunshine Hours in Side
Side can be enjoyed more throughout the sunniest month of July under a blue sky, with approximately 10.4 hours of sunshine daily. In contrast, the city experiences much darker days in December, with only 4.4 hours of sunlight per day.

Best Time to Visit Side
Monthly ratings reflect general weather comfort, based on daytime temperature and rainfall. Swimming and winter conditions are highlighted separately where relevant.
- Best overall: April, May, June and October
- Warmest weather: July and August
- Most sunshine: June and July
- Fewest rainy days: June and September
- Best for swimming: May, June, July, August, September, October and November.
- Wettest months: January, February, March, October, November and December, when rainfall is highest.
- Seasonal pattern: A distinct dry season from June to September, with very warm summers and mild winters
Frequently asked questions about the climate in Side
What is the best time to visit Side?
April, May, June and October typically offer the most optimal weather in Side. In contrast, January and December tend to have less optimal conditions. Side has a distinct dry season from June to September, with very warm summers and mild winters.
What temperatures can I expect in Side?
Daytime highs range from 15°C (59°F) in January to 33°C (91°F) in August. Nighttime lows range from 8°C (46°F) to 25°C (77°F). Temperatures vary considerably through the year.
How much rain does Side get?
Annual rainfall is around 1005 mm (40 in). January is the wettest month with 205 mm (8.1 in), while July is the driest with 4 mm (0.2 in).
How sunny is Side?
Side receives around 2,657 hours of sunshine per year. July is the sunniest month with 312 hours, while December is the cloudiest with just 133 hours. Overall, Side enjoys abundant sunshine.
